How Much Money Do I Need to Start a Roofing Company in West Palm Beach, Florida?

Roofer goes through client paperwork.

Categories :

Starting a roofing company can be a rewarding venture, especially in a growing coastal city like West Palm Beach, Florida, where real estate and infrastructure demand continue to rise. But one of the most common and practical questions aspiring entrepreneurs ask is: How much money do I need to start a roofing company? The answer isn’t one-size-fits-all, but with a clear understanding of startup costs, regulatory requirements, and local market dynamics, you can map out a smart, financially sound path toward launching your business.

Roofer goes through client paperwork.

This article will break down the essential startup costs, explore the nuances of doing business in Palm Beach County, and highlight key considerations unique to the roofing industry in South Florida.

🏗️ Estimated Startup Costs for a Roofing Business

The total investment required to launch a roofing company in West Palm Beach typically ranges between $15,000 and $40,000, depending on your scale, service offerings, and business model (e.g., subcontracting vs. full-service). Here’s a breakdown of what contributes to those numbers:

1. Licensing and Registration$500–$2,000

To operate legally in Florida, you’ll need a Certified Roofing Contractor License through the Florida Department of Business and Professional Regulation (DBPR). This includes:

  • Application and exam fees
  • Background check
  • Insurance verification
  • Financial stability documentation

Local business licenses and permits from the City of West Palm Beach and Palm Beach County are also required.

2. Insurance and Bonding$3,000–$10,000 annually

Roofing is a high-liability trade, especially in a hurricane-prone region like South Florida. You’ll need:

  • General liability insurance
  • Workers’ compensation insurance
  • Surety bond (usually required for licensing)

Your costs will vary based on team size and claims history.

3. Tools and Equipment$5,000–$15,000

For residential roofing, you’ll need:

  • Nail guns, ladders, scaffolding
  • Roofing safety harnesses
  • Circular saws, utility knives, measuring tools
  • Work trucks or trailers

In West Palm Beach, where clay tile, metal, and asphalt shingles are all common, versatility in your tools is critical.

4. Marketing and Branding$1,000–$5,000

Your ability to acquire leads early is vital. Roofing is competitive in Palm Beach County, so your marketing foundation should include:

  • Logo and branding kit
  • Basic website (optimized for “roofing services in West Palm Beach”, “licensed roofers near me,” and other LSI keywords)
  • Google Business Profile
  • SEO-optimized landing pages
  • Local advertising (Nextdoor, Facebook, flyers, etc.)

5. Initial Inventory and Materials$3,000–$8,000

If you’re offering full-service roofing (materials + labor), you’ll need to stock common materials like:

  • Underlayment
  • Asphalt shingles
  • Roofing nails
  • Flashing and sealants

In West Palm Beach’s humid, coastal environment, materials must meet Florida Building Code standards for wind uplift and salt resistance.

6. Labor and Payroll SetupVaries

If you plan to hire, initial payroll expenses can include:

  • Employee recruitment
  • Onboarding costs
  • Training (especially in OSHA compliance and Florida-specific codes)
  • Payroll software setup

Consider starting lean—perhaps with subcontractors or day laborers—while your business gains traction.

🌴 Unique Considerations for West Palm Beach, FL

The West Palm Beach roofing market is shaped by a few hyperlocal realities that directly impact your startup costs and operational planning.

🌀 Hurricane Preparedness

Florida’s building code is among the strictest in the nation. Roofing companies must ensure materials and installation methods meet wind resistance ratings. This affects:

  • Insurance premiums
  • Material costs (e.g., storm-rated shingles)
  • Labor (roofers may need additional certifications)

See roofing contractors for more.

🏘️ Demographic Diversity

West Palm Beach’s neighborhoods vary widely—from historic Spanish-style homes in Flamingo Park to modern estates in El Cid. Each roofing project can involve different materials and expectations.

Offering flexible services, such as tile roof repair, metal roof installations, and solar-ready roofing, can help you appeal to high-end clients and sustainable-minded homeowners.

🏗️ Licensing Pathway

To operate legally, you need a Certified Roofing Contractor License, which allows you to work across Florida. If you only want to work in West Palm Beach or surrounding counties, a Registered License is sufficient—but comes with limitations. Each route involves exams and financial criteria, so be prepared to demonstrate a net worth of at least $20,000 and submit credit reports and proof of experience.

🧠 Budget Optimization Tips

If you’re trying to keep your startup costs closer to the $15K mark:

  • Start small: Focus on repairs and inspections, which require fewer materials and smaller crews.
  • Use subcontractors: Instead of hiring full-time staff right away, partner with local licensed crews on a per-job basis.
  • Rent equipment: Avoid upfront purchases for items like trailers or compressors.
  • DIY marketing: Learn basic SEO, use free tools like Google Business Profile, and lean into social proof through testimonials and referrals.

💡 Local SEO Strategy for Roofers in West Palm Beach

To get found by clients searching for roofing services, your digital presence must be SEO-optimized for location-based queries. Key components include:

  • Including phrases like “licensed roofer West Palm Beach”, “new roof Palm Beach County”, and “Florida roofing contractor near me”
  • Creating dedicated service pages for re-roofing, storm damage repair, gutter installation, and roof inspections
  • Listing your business in local directories, such as the Palm Beach Chamber of Commerce, HomeAdvisor, and Nextdoor
  • Encouraging satisfied customers to leave Google Reviews

📈 Scaling Your Roofing Business

Once your foundation is solid, growth opportunities in West Palm Beach are abundant. Consider:

  • Partnering with real estate agents, property managers, or home insurance agents
  • Adding services like gutter installation, roof cleaning, or solar panel mounting
  • Investing in drone technology for faster inspections and digital quoting
  • Expanding your service area into surrounding cities like Lake Worth, Boynton Beach, and Delray Beach

💬 Final Thoughts

So, how much money do you need to start a roofing company in West Palm Beach? Depending on your ambition and setup, plan for at least $15,000 on the low end and up to $40,000 or more for a fully branded, equipped, and legally compliant operation.

But more than money, success in the roofing business comes from local expertise, strong service delivery, and strategic visibility. With West Palm Beach’s growing housing market and frequent weather-related roofing needs, the timing couldn’t be better to lay the foundation for your roofing company.

Ready to rise above the competition? Lay your first shingle—smartly, legally, and strategically—in sunny West Palm Beach, Florida.